Spool to existing file
how do i append to an already existing spool file
if i say spool to an already existing file it overwrites the
contents. i wnat to keep the old contents also.
AFAIK you can't do this with a humble spool statement. If you
want to do this you can either:
(1) write a shell script that copies the old file to a new name
before running the SQL statement and then sticks the two files
together afterwards; or
(2) use UTL_FILE

How to use UTL_SMTP to send email with existing file attachment
Hello! I am trying to create a pl/sql procedure that lets me send an email and include an existing file to a email address. So far, I found information on how to send a file and create an attachment with information I put in the procedure. This is NOT what I'm trying to do. I'm trying to send an email and include an attachment for a file that already exists. I need the pre-existing file to be sent to the email recipient.
This is how far I've gotten, but this only allows me to CREATE an attachment with the information I put in it from the procedure. I got it from the following site:
http://www.orafaq.com/wiki/Send_mail_from_PL/SQL
DECLARE
v_From VARCHAR2(80) := '[email protected]';
v_Recipient VARCHAR2(80) := '[email protected]';
v_Subject VARCHAR2(80) := 'Weekly Invoice Report';
v_Mail_Host VARCHAR2(30) := 'mail.mycompany.com';
v_Mail_Conn utl_smtp.Connection;
crlf VARCHAR2(2) := chr(13)||chr(10);
BEGIN
v_Mail_Conn := utl_smtp.Open_Connection(v_Mail_Host, 25);
utl_smtp.Helo(v_Mail_Conn, v_Mail_Host);
utl_smtp.Mail(v_Mail_Conn, v_From);
utl_smtp.Rcpt(v_Mail_Conn, v_Recipient);
utl_smtp.Data(v_Mail_Conn,
'Date: ' || to_char(sysdate, 'Dy, DD Mon YYYY hh24:mi:ss') || crlf ||
'From: ' || v_From || crlf ||
'Subject: '|| v_Subject || crlf ||
'To: ' || v_Recipient || crlf ||
'MIME-Version: 1.0'|| crlf || -- Use MIME mail standard
'Content-Type: multipart/mixed;'|| crlf ||
' boundary="-----SECBOUND"'|| crlf ||
crlf ||
'-------SECBOUND'|| crlf ||
'Content-Type: text/plain;'|| crlf ||
'Content-Transfer_Encoding: 7bit'|| crlf ||
crlf ||
'This is a test'|| crlf || -- Message body
'of the email attachment'|| crlf ||
crlf ||
'-------SECBOUND'|| crlf ||
'Content-Type: text/plain;'|| crlf ||
' name="ap_inv_supplier_cc10.txt"'|| crlf ||
'Content-Transfer_Encoding: 8bit'|| crlf ||
'Content-Disposition: attachment;'|| crlf ||
' filename="ap_inv_supplier_cc10.txt"'|| crlf ||
crlf ||
'TXT,file,attachment'|| crlf || -- Content of attachment (THIS IS MY PROBLEM! I NEED TO BE ABLE TO ATTACH AN EXISTING FILE, NOT CREATE A NEW ONE)
crlf ||
'-------SECBOUND--' -- End MIME mail
utl_smtp.Quit(v_mail_conn);
EXCEPTION
WHEN utl_smtp.Transient_Error OR utl_smtp.Permanent_Error then
raise_application_error(-20000, 'Unable to send mail: '||sqlerrm);
END;
/First, you must create a directory object
create directory ORALOAD as '/home/ldcgroup/ldccbc/'
/Study the Prerequisites in the link I posted above, or else you will not be able to read/write files from the above directory object
"fname" relates to the file name that you read from.
In the code below, it is also the name of the file that you are attaching.
Although they can be different!
l_Output is the contents of the file.
declare
vInHandle utl_file.file_type;
flen number;
bsize number;
ex boolean;
l_Output raw(32767);
fname varchar2(30) := 'ap_inv_supplier_cc10.txt';
vSender varchar2(30) := '[email protected]';
vRecip varchar2(30) := '[email protected]';
vSubj varchar2(50) := 'Weekly Invoice Report';
vAttach varchar2(50) := 'ap_inv_supplier_cc10.txt';
vMType varchar2(30) := 'text/plain; charset=us-ascii';
begin
utl_file.fgetattr('ORALOAD', fname, ex, flen, bsize);
vInHandle := utl_file.fopen('ORALOAD', fname, 'R');
utl_file.get_raw (vInHandle, l_Output);
utl_file.fclose(vInHandle);
utl_mail.send_attach_raw(sender => vSender
,recipients => vRecip
,subject => vsubj
,attachment => l_Output
,att_inline => false
,att_filename => fname);
end;
/ -

How do I add an existing file to a project?
To add an existing files to a project in JDeveloper 9.0.5.2 I use File/Import and select "Existing Sources". In Jdeveloper 10.1.3.0.2 the "Existing Sources" option was substituted by "Create Project from Existing Source". The documentation topic in 10.1.3 âAdding Existing Files to an Existing Project Using the Add Files or Directories Dialogâ indicates File/Open and use a âAdd Files or Directories dialogâ that I can not find.
How do I add an existing file to a project?To add an existing files to a project in JDeveloper
9.0.5.2 I use File/Import and select "Existing
Sources". In Jdeveloper 10.1.3.0.2 the "Existing
Sources" option was substituted by "Create Project
from Existing Source". The documentation topic in
10.1.3 âAdding Existing Files to an Existing
Project Using the Add Files or Directories Dialogâ
indicates File/Open and use a âAdd Files or
Directories dialogâ that I can not find.
How do I add an existing file to a project?Right now you just need to copy the file into the sourcepath of your project, going forward we're going to provide some easier way to do this.
i.e. you can use the windows explorer to copy C:\src\com\acme\MyClass.java to C:\jdev\mywork\Application1\Project1\src\com\acme\MyClass.java
